Question 6
A marketing manager wants a broad range of campaign concepts before selecting any one direction. The brand tone and budget limits are known, and the team will later shortlist concepts using those constraints. Which prompting approach would BEST support this process?
Show Answer & Explanation
Correct Answer: C
Correct answer (C): This approach separates divergent thinking from convergent evaluation. It first encourages meaningful variety by identifying dimensions along which concepts should differ, reducing the likelihood of receiving numerous near-duplicates. It then uses the known brand and budget constraints to assess the alternatives. That sequence supports the team’s goal of exploring broadly before narrowing the field. The constraints still guide the eventual shortlist, but they do not prematurely force the ideation process toward a single concept.
Why the other options are wrong:
- Option A: Multiple executions may provide surface-level variation, but fixing one theme at the outset undermines the team’s goal of broad concept exploration.
- Option B: A polished recommendation appears actionable, but it combines idea generation and selection before the team has considered a meaningful range of alternatives.
- Option D: A large quantity can help exploration, but quantity alone does not ensure diversity, and selecting the first acceptable idea bypasses comparison.
